Abstract
The sol-gel transformation mechanisms of tetraisopropyl orthotitanate (TIPT ) derived coatings were qualitatively studied by Fourier transform infrared (FTIR) spectroscopy. Kinetics studies were carried out in the liquid state for purl and diluted precursor. Xerogel film resulting from a stable isopr opoxide-derived sol with low water content and acidic pH was also studied a s a function of time. The absorption band evolution was followed, from the non-hydrolysed metal isopropoxide until the xerogel thin film formation. Th is evolution was interpreted and discussed in terms of TiO2 sol-gel reactio ns (hydrolysis, reesterification or transesterification, condensation). (C) 1999 Elsevier Science S.A.
